The objective of the stakeholder dialogue is to: • Support the committee to effectively consider stakeholders actions, as well as needs and interests in the intergovernmental negotiations. • Further facilitate a two-way dialogue between Member States and stakeholders to allow for a diversity of voices during the negotiations on the historic resolution to develop a legally binding
instrument. • Provide a space to share ideas with the committee on the future of the multi-stakeholder forum and dialogue as well as on how to initiate a multi-stakeholder action agenda. 2. The stakeholder dialogue will build upon the key outcomes of the Multi-stakeholder Forum, taking place in conjunction with the INC-1 on 26 November 2022. The key outcomes and messages from
the Forum will be summarized at the opening of the dialogue’s session. | en_US |
